Victoria’s much anticipated container deposit scheme, CDS Vic, began on 1 November 2023.

CDS Vic will allow Victorians to return certain used drink cans, bottles and cartons for a 10-cent refund. 

To date over a billion containers have been returned.

There are 3 Return-It depots in Rosebud, Dromana and Mornington together with one in Hastings run by Hoxton Industries:

  • 1/8 Henry Wilson Drive, Rosebud
  • 32 Brasser Avenue, Dromana
  • 42 Watt Road, Mornington

There are also many Over the Counter locations across the Peninsula.

Return-It has been confirmed as the Container Deposit Scheme network operator for Mornington Peninsula Shire.

For charities, community groups and sports club, Return-It can provide 240L wheelie bins or bulk bags to assist with collecting and transporting containers to the depots.
